Also, as far as I know, table funcition for WRITER will be redesigned in OOo 2. How can we handle this wish? Rainer Hi Rainer, I think the situation in writer is more complex then in calc. In calc the settings for the font, for styles of numbers and for background and alignment all belong to the cell. Therefore in calc cell-formatting via stylist is implemented. In writer the settings are spread to table and to paragraph, which is right, because you can have a lot of paragraphs and objects within one cell. "Table Contents" and "Table Heading" are paragraph-styles and no cell-styles as discussed here. There allready exists a kind of 'stylist' for tables; it is the 'AutoFormat', but it deals with whole tables and you cannot update your selfmade tablestyle. Having cell-styles in the stylist would be nice, but the stylist becomes more extensive because you need a new category. Anyway I have voted for this issue, because such capability will give an easy way to design tables. In writer a style-template via stylist would be helpfull, because you have - in contrast to calc - not the possibility to transfer a format with 'PasteSpecial'.
